Pattie Piotrowski: "Excitement is growing at the University of Illinois Springfield as construction is underway on the new Library Commons building. The publicly funded project was made possible by a $42.5 million investment from the state of Illinois. The three-story, 52,000-square-foot building is being built next to the Student Union and is expected to open in 2027."
"The Library Commons will provide easy access to a comprehensive range of resources, programming and services that support academic skill development and independent learning. This dynamic new space is designed to transform the student experience. Students will benefit from expanded group study areas and shared learning spaces that provide opportunities to connect with others and access resources. Whether working on a group project, preparing for a presentation or seeking a quiet space for focused study, students will find environments tailored to their diverse needs."
